"When it comes to tenor saxophone sounds, Jerry Weldon has one of the biggest, and warmest, around." — The Star Ledger

Massimo Farao' is a wonderful Italian pianist who has played and recorded with Red Holloway, Albert "Tootie" Heath, Tony Scott, Franco Ambrosetti, Nat Adderley, Jeff Tain Watts, Jack DeJohnette and Chris Potter, among others. Farao's passionate style and stoic romanticism are very attractive along with the rich harmonies he creates.

Veteran tenor sax man Jerry Weldon joined the legendary Lionel Hampton Orchestra in 1981 and has worked with dozens of jazz luminaries over the past three plus decades. In 1990, Jerry joined Harry Connick Jr.'s newly formed big band and now, Jerry can be seen daily as part of the "house band" on "Harry," Connick's new daytime variety show. Jerry can also regularly be found gigging, both as a leader and a sideman, at clubs in the New York area...and beyond.
